Starting a Handyman Business
By Ken Marlborough
Starting any business is easy but to sustain that business and get repeat orders from your client is what determines the success of your business. The same applies to starting a handyman business. You should do simple research on the potential of this handyman business before you put your hard-earned money here. Statistics reveal that around 100 million households are there in the country and about 70% of them are more than 15 years old. So you should judge by this factor that there is tremendous potential for the maintenance, upgrading, remodeling and renovation business. The owners of residential building often seek the assistance of the handyman for the benefit of their tenants.
Some of the basics for your own handyman business is a home office. You need to employ people who will do the work for you. You should have them on your payroll. Selecting such competitive people to work for you is a tedious task, but you have to do that to sustain. And you need to invest some money to start. And the most important of all is that you should have the right contacts to spread the word about your business. It is better if you have some contacts/clients already. Marketing your business is important to get clients. If all these tasks are tough for you to do then there is an easy way to start the same business. A franchise agreement with some reputed Handyman Business firm is not a bad way to get started.
Going for a franchise with a reputed firm would help you to launch your business and get started immediately. There are several advantages of going for a franchise. You get all the clients that the company has from day one. You save a lot of time in getting your clients. The staff of the company helps you to set up your business and even recruits good people. All you have to do is set the schedule for the work you get. When you go for a franchise, you may have to pay a royalty for the company you are approaching and there are stringent rules and regulations that you have to meet to open your own franchise. Check out the companies that offer such franchises to get started.

Advantages And Disadvantages Of A Handyman Franchise
By Tom Brinic
A handyman business is one of the most lucrative businesses in the country, and even the world, mainly because most people do not have the means or the time to repair and maintain their houses. Even if you are a small-time handyman service provider, you are ensured of regular and consistent flow of projects because there are over 100 million households in the country.
Even if there are many home improvements and do-it-yourself books on home repair and maintenance, many still get the services of their local handyman for both minor and major repairs because they do not have to do the work themselves. The need for handyman service is expected to rise even more in the future because of the climbing elderly population and the rising number of dual-income earners.
If you just want to enter the US$30 billion handyman industry, but do not have the expertise to open up your own shop, then you can opt to try a handyman business franchise. In franchising a business, you don't need to think of a business idea and even a business formula.
Benefits of franchising a handyman business
The most obvious advantage of entering the handyman industry is its prospect for growth. As mentioned earlier, the potential of the handyman industry of becoming bigger in the future is expected. Most people will want to put their money in a business or industry that is reliable and has a good chance of success.
If you want to lower the risk of failure, then business franchising is for you. A handyman franchise, or any business franchise for that matter, will provide you with ample training and support to help you succeed. Since royalty fees are based on the performance of franchisees, the company or business that you will be franchising would want you and your business to flourish and succeed.
When you buy a franchise, you are basically paying for the right to use the business model, system, name, credibility and branding or trademark of a company. Thus, you don't need to think of making up a brand of your own. Moreover, people will tend to trust your business more than the ones that are just starting because they are familiar with the name and the brand that you are carrying.
Starting a business from scratch is a long and tedious process because you have to make your own model, name, and system. However, if you buy a franchise, you can start almost immediately after paying for the franchising fee and getting all the necessary government permits.
From day one, the company whose business franchise you will be buying will be there to help you from looking for the perfect place to set up the shop to recruiting employees.
Disadvantages of franchising a handyman business
One of the major disadvantages of buying a franchise is cost. You will almost always need more money to buy a franchise than setting up your own business. Aside from the usually high franchise fees, you also need to pay monthly or yearly royalty fees for as long as you are a franchisee.
If you are a person who wants utmost freedom in managing your business, then franchising is not for you. If you buy a handyman franchise, you have to abide by the rules and regulations. More often than not, failure to comply with the rules will result to the revocation of your franchise.
Franchising a business, whether it’s a handyman business or not, is not for everybody. Thus, you need to really take in consideration your personality and leadership style, before even paying for a franchise fee.
